How to save phone number to Xiaomi phone: all ways with instructions

Saving phone numbers on Xiaomi smartphones (including the Redmi, POCO and Mi series) seems like a simple task โ€” until you encounter unexpected problems. From contacts disappear after resetting, then duplicated during synchronization, then not displayed in instant messengers. In this article, we will discuss all the current ways to save numbers, from manual input to automatic synchronization with cloud services, and also tell you how to avoid typical errors that cause loss of important contacts.

Xiaomi phones feature the MIUI, which imposes its own rules on the work with contacts. For example, here by default can be enabled synchronization with Mi Account, not Google, which confuses users accustomed to โ€œcleanโ€ Android. We will discuss in detail how to configure the save so that the numbers never disappear even after changing the phone or flashing.

1. Manual entry of the number: the basic method

The most obvious method is to add a contact manually through the Contacts app, which is good if you need to save 1-2 numbers, but becomes tedious with a large volume.

  1. Open the Contacts app (a icon with a person's silhouette).
  2. Press the + button in the lower right corner.
  3. Choose where to keep contact: ๐Ÿ“ฑ Device โ€“ the number will only be stored in the phoneโ€™s memory (risk of loss when resetting). โ˜๏ธ Google โ€“ syncs with your account (recommended). ๐Ÿ”„ Mi Account โ€“ Save to the Xiaomi Cloud (an alternative to Google).

Fill in the fields: name, number, additional data (email, address, etc.).

Save.

โš ๏ธ Note: If you choose to save to your device, contact will not be available on other gadgets and may disappear after resetting.

To quickly add a number from the call log, open the Phone, find the desired call, click on it and select Save to Contacts.

2. Import of contacts from SIM-card

Many users still keep numbers on the SIM-To transfer them to Xiaomi, take the following steps:

  1. Open Contacts. โ†’ press three points (โ‹ฎ) top-right.
  2. Select Contact Management โ†’ Import/export of contacts.
  3. Press Import with SIM-map.
  4. Check the necessary contacts (or select Allocate).
  5. Specify your target account for saving (Google or Mi Account is recommended).
  6. Confirm the import.

After importing, check that the contacts appear in the main list. If some numbers are not moved, they may be in an incorrect format (for example, with extra characters).

What to do if your contacts are SIM-mapless?
If the phone does not see the contact SIM, Check: 1. Is the card inserted correctly (chip up). 2. Does your Xiaomi model support the format SIM-contact (obsolete models may not read the records). 3. Is not damaged SIM-If the problem persists, transfer the contacts to another medium (for example, export to the file). VCF old-phone).

3. Synchronization with Google: a reliable way

Syncing with a Google account is the most reliable method of maintaining contacts, allowing you to restore numbers on any Android device, even after losing or replacing your phone.

  1. Open Settings โ†’ Accounts and Synchronization.
  2. Select Google and log in to your account (if you are not already logged in).
  3. Activate the Contact Switch.
  4. Press More (โ‹ฎ) โ†’ Synchronize now.

โš ๏ธ Note: If you have previously saved contacts to your device, you must first export them to Google. โ†’ Contact management โ†’ Imports/exports โ†’ Export to the device (save the file) VCF), Then import it into Google.

4.Export and import of contacts via VCF file

The.vcf file (vCard) is a universal format for backing up contacts, which can be transferred to another phone, sent by email or saved to the cloud.

Export of contacts:

  1. Open Contacts. โ†’ Contact management โ†’ Imports/exports.
  2. Select Export to the device.
  3. Mark your contacts for export (or select All).
  4. Click Export and save the file in your phoneโ€™s memory.

Import of contacts:

  1. Copy the.vcf file to your phone (for example, via Google Drive or USB cable).
  2. In Contacts, select Import from the device.
  3. Specify the file and target account to save.

๐Ÿ“Œ Tip: Regularly (once in a week) 1-2 months) export contacts to the file VCF And you save it to the cloud (Google Drive, Mi Cloud). It's insurance in case of sync failure.

5. Backup through Mi Cloud

Xiaomi offers its own cloud storage, the Mi Cloud, which automatically backs up contacts if synchronization is enabled.

  1. Open Settings โ†’ Mi Account (or Accounts and Sync โ†’ Mi Account).
  2. Sign in to your Xiaomi account (sign up if you donโ€™t have an account yet).
  3. Activate the Contact Switch.
  4. Press Sync.

To check the backup:

  • ๐ŸŒ Go to i.mi.com.
  • ๐Ÿ” Contacts should show all saved numbers.

โš ๏ธ Note: If you use both Google and Mi Account for sync, you may experience duplicate contacts. To avoid this, select one primary account and disable sync in the other.

6.Moving contacts from iPhone to Xiaomi

If you're switching from an iPhone to Xiaomi, you can transfer contacts in a number of ways, and the most reliable is through your Google account.

Method 1: Through Google Account

  1. On iPhone, open Settings โ†’ Contacts โ†’ Accounts.
  2. Add a Google account and enable contact sync.
  3. Wait for the sync to complete (check at contacts.google.com).
  4. On Xiaomi, log in to the same Google account and enable sync.

Method 2: Through the VCF file

  1. On your iPhone, open iCloud.com and log in to your account.
  2. Go to Contacts, highlight everything and click on the gear โ†’ Export vCard.
  3. Copy the file to Xiaomi (e.g. via email or cloud).
  4. Import the file through Contacts โ†’ Import/Export.

๐Ÿ“Œ Important: When transferring from your iPhone, check the format of phone numbers. Sometimes they are saved with a country prefix (for example, for example, +7 instead of 8), which can cause problems with the number determinant on Xiaomi.

7 Recovery of remote contacts

If contacts are accidentally deleted, they can be restored โ€” but only if sync with Google or Mi Cloud was enabled.

Recovery via Google:

  1. Open contacts.google.com.
  2. In the left menu, select Cancel Changes.
  3. Please indicate the time range (up to 30 days ago).
  4. Confirm recovery.

Recovery through Mi Cloud:

  1. Go to i.mi.com.
  2. In the Contacts section, find the Recycle Bin (available within 30 days of removal).
  3. Select the necessary contacts and click Restore.

โš ๏ธ Note: If synchronization has been disabled, you can only restore contacts from a local backup (file) VCF), If it was done in advance, you can't get back the deleted numbers without a backup.

Frequent Mistakes and How to Avoid Them

Even experienced users sometimes face problems with maintaining contacts on Xiaomi, and here are the most common mistakes and ways to solve them:

  • ๐Ÿ”„ Duplicate contacts: occurs when you sync with Google and Mi Account at the same time. Solution โ€“ disable sync in one of the accounts and delete duplicates manually (or use the Contacts app). โ†’ Contact management โ†’ Combine the takes).
  • ๐Ÿ“ต Contacts are not displayed in messengers: check that the numbers are saved in an international format (for example, the number is not in the same format, +79123456789, not 89123456789).
  • โš ๏ธ Loss of contact after update MIUI: Before updating, make a backup through Settings โ†’ The phone. โ†’ Backup.
  • ๐Ÿ”’ You can not edit contacts: if the contact is saved SIM-Transfer it to Google or to your device.

Can I save contacts on Xiaomi without a Google or Mi Account?
Yes, but it's not safe. You can save contacts directly to your device (in your phone's memory), but they will disappear when you reset or replace your gadget.
Why are your contacts not synced with Google?
The reasons may be: No Internet connection. Sync is disabled in account settings (Settings โ†’ Accounts and Sync โ†’ Google); Not enough space in a Google account (check on one.google.com); Google services error (solved by rebooting your phone or updating the Google Contacts app).
How to transfer contacts from the old Xiaomi to the new?
The easiest way to do this is to use Mi Cloud: On your old phone, enable Mi Account Contact Sync. On your new phone, log in to the same Xiaomi account and enable sync. Wait until the process is complete (check in Contacts). Alternatively, export contacts to the VCF file on your old phone and import them on your new phone.
Can I keep contacts on the flash drive?
Yes, but only as a VCF file. For this: Export contacts to a file (as described in section 4). Copy the file to a flash drive via Explorer. However, it is inconvenient for regular use - it is better to configure cloud sync.
What if your phone is lost after resetting?
If you have synced with Google or Mi Cloud before reset: Sign in to your account on your phone. Enable contact sync. Wait for recovery (may take a few minutes). If sync hasn't been set up, try restoring contacts from a MIUI backup (if it was created) or a VCF file.
